This one works wonders with low power cars. At pretty much any point of the corner, even before it for extra kudos (but harder to get oversteer), if you press the clutch, accelerate to rev up for a moment and release the clutch while turning, the rear tires will lose traction, sending the car into a drift.

WebFeb 19, 2024 · A clutch kick is a brief stab of a manual transmission car’s clutch pedal, to briefly raise the revs when you need to tap into a little extra energy but don’t want to … WebThe most common mistake is to give way too much wheel on initiation, which cause a somewhat unrecoverable oversteer. You should initiate drift by GENTLY breaking traction, not a massive scandinavian flick. clutch kick, hand brake, drop a gear without clutching or just stab the brakes with a slight angle is enough to initiate a drift. fmcsa distracted driving
